Seacoast Banking Corp of Florida is a holding company. The company provides integrated financial services, including commercial and consumer banking, wealth management, and mortgage and insurance services, to customers across Florida through branch, mobile, and online banking solutions. It maintains day-to-day operations, particularly in the areas of operations, treasury management systems, information technology, and security. The company has one reportable segment that provides these integrated financial services, with segment revenues driven mainly by interest and fees on loans, interest on cash and cash equivalents, and investment securities, and fees on depository products and services.
Advance Auto Parts is a leading auto-parts retailer in North America with more than 4,000 store and branch locations. About half of the firm's sales are geared toward the professional channel, with the remaining sales in the do-it-yourself market. Through its vast store footprint and distribution network, Advance manages thousands of stock-keeping units for various vehicle makes and models. The retailer primarily competes on inventory availability and service speed, making the operating efficiency of its hub-and-spoke distribution model critical to meeting customer needs.
